Transaction 58ec2c7b60a0f722348a5ef679699de7dec301d3ca70df8322eded60cceab84c
1 Input
1 Output
-
58ec2c7b60a0f722348a5ef679699de7dec301d3ca70df8322eded60cceab84c:0
- value
- 13675033
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5730fcc05075d8e2929e2d6f3f65e7dfe28413d9 OP_EQUAL
- address
- 39e3Pvwv4ZT2ycrdtHGJgLa9ypTwNCMYc8